Broken Glass

Broken glass is an issue that occurs in many businesses and homes. It can be caused by a variety of factors, including children throwing baseballs at upvc windows near me or bumping a mirror off the wall. It's a hassle and a pain to deal with broken glass, regardless of what the reason.

The most important thing is to remove broken glass pieces. This is crucial because broken glass, particularly when it is broken in small pieces, repairmywindowsanddoors could be dangerous. Glass can cut skin and create cuts similar to sharp needles, sharp knives and razors. It can also pose a health risk because it is contaminated with blood, toxic chemicals and infectious agents that enter the body via a cut or puncture.

Glass that has cracked can be repaired using Bostik Fix & Glue. This adhesive can be used to repair glass items with short impact cracks like picture frames, window panes, door sidelights mirrors, glassware for kitchens. It can also be used on single pane window glass, as well as automotive glass. Cracks must be clean and dry to ensure that the glue is adhered.

The adhesive can be applied with a fine nozzle. The areas to be repaired should be gently pressed together. This will enable the adhesive to bond immediately and stop the cracks from spreading. However, it's important to remember that small cracks may be visible after repair but they won't be as obvious as they were before. It's also important to stay clear of extreme temperature fluctuations because the cracks may expand and contract, which could cause further damage.

Broken Locks

When your lock stops working properly, it could leave your home vulnerable to burglars. If you have a DIY repair kit, you can fix broken locks yourself without needing to engage an expert. First, you must determine the root cause of the problem. There are a variety of possible problems, such as an alignment issue with the mechanical system or the key is damaged. It is essential to have the lock fixed quickly prior to causing other issues.

If you're able to turn the key inside the lock, but it does not remain in, you may require replacing the latch bolt, or the lock cylinder itself. You should also examine the hinges and frame of the door for any looseness or damage. This could be a different reason why your lock is broken.

A jiggly-lock indicates that the bolt has not entered or exited the strike plate in a proper manner. You can fix this issue by moving the strike plate slightly. Be careful not to move it too much. Moving the strike plate too much can leave the holes for the set screws too wide, resulting in an unstable lock.

If you've found dust or rust in the keyway, it's likely that the key won't turn. Try using a lubricant spray to ease the key's movement. You can also apply an oil-based lubricant that is dry such as graphite powder.

A spinning lock indicates that the tailpiece in the lock has been damaged. This is typically a cheap part to purchase from a locksmith, and it can be replaced in just a few minutes.

A key that is bent poses a serious security risk as it can snap off within the lock and stop you from opening your door. You can flatten and shape the key with the aid of a vise. If you don't have a vise, you can also place the key between two pieces of wood and hit it with a hammer or other heavy object. This will reduce the size of the key and improve its ability to fit into the lock.

Broken Rollers

The rollers keep your door in the right alignment. If they're damaged, your door could slide off the track. However, replacing the rollers can be a relatively easy home repair task for many homeowners. First, you must remove the sliding panel of the door from its track and put it aside until you need to.

Find the screws for adjustment of the roller on the bottom of your door frame and loosen them. This will let you lift the door to access the broken roller. Note the exact location of the old roller to ensure that the replacement is placed exactly where it was.

Then, remove the roller from the track and check it for any damage. If you discover that the roller has been bent, you can use a pair of metal benders to bend it back in place. If you're not able to bend the roller back into its original position, you may need to replace it completely. Once you've received the new roller, put it in place it using the same procedure for removing the old one.

While you're there, you might also be thinking about lubricating your rollers. This will reduce friction and make it easier for the door to move smoothly. Just be sure to use a lubricant that isn't petroleum-based, since petroleum-based ones tend to attract dirt faster.

Once you're finished take care to lower the door back onto the track. Make sure that all of the bolts or screws that you removed are returned and reinstalled properly, and that all of the components are aligned properly. Also, make sure to adjust the roller's height when required. It should be at a point where the door doesn't touch the threshold, but it should still be in a position to roll easily.

After a few attempts after a few tries, you should be successful in replacing the roller and getting your door functioning smoothly once again. If you aren't confident in your ability to complete the job, it's always best to consult a professional. A professional can assess the issue more quickly and determine the best course.

Broken Hinges

In time, the weight of the door could make the hinges loose. This is especially the case when the screw holes in the door frame have been stripped. This is a common issue which can be easily fixed with a little effort. To fix the issue, you can apply a simple procedure that involves drilling out the old screw and using dowels to fill the hole before putting in a new screw.

This method is particularly beneficial for wooden frames and is a better choice instead of trying to tighten long screws in the stripped hole. Using long screws can distort the existing wood and could cause further issues. The method allows dowels of the same size as the holes, which provide the most secure and durable fix.

You should check the size of the screw prior to making a new hole. This can be done by using a spirit level to verify the screw's location. Once you have figured out the location of the screw hole, you can drill out the old screw. It shouldn't be too difficult since the screw holes can often be enlarged by the screws.

Then, take a measurement of the thickness of your door Repairmywindowsanddoors jamb. Cut lengths of dowels made of hardwood that are just a little less than the measurement. After the dowels have been cut, they should be put into the new screw hole. Carpenter glue should be applied to both sides.

Once the glue has had an opportunity to dry, it is then necessary to drill the new screw into the dowel as well as the hole for the hinge. Once the screw is installed, it is crucial to give the dowel time to fully tighten.

It is a good practice to spray lubricant on your door hinges on a regular schedule. This will prevent any future issues. This will stop them from becoming stuck in either the closed or open positions. You can find a oil for hinges on doors at your local home improvement shop.
